FAST FABULOUS FRITTATA

by Delaine dEchellis

2strips bacon, cut in 1/2 inch pieces

1onion, slivered

1red pepper, cut into strips

1green pepper, cut into strips

2tablespoons olive oil

4eggs, slightly beaten

3tablespoons milk

1tablespoon parsley, chopped

Salt and pepper to taste

Cook bacon in 10-inch ovenproof skillet on medium heat about 6 minutes. Remove bacon to a paper towel. Reduce to low heat. Add onions and peppers to skillet. Add extra oil, if needed. Saute 5 minutes. Remove from heat and add bacon pieces. Preheat broiler. Beat eggs, milk, parsley and seasonings in bowl. Pour over vegetables in skillet. Cook the mixture on medium heat until bottom is set and top is slightly wet. Place under broiler 4 to 6 inches from heat until top of frittata is puffy, about 2 to 3 minutes. Slice in wedges and serve.

HEARTY WINTER MINESTRONE SOUP

by NINA MELFI

3/4pound Italian sausage, casings removed

1tablespoon vegetable oil

1/2cup carrots, sliced

1/2cup celery, sliced

1/2cup green pepper, cut in 1/2-inch strips

1can beef broth

1can Zesty tomato soup

11/2cups water

1cup bow-tie pasta

Shape sausage into 3/4-inch meatballs. In a saucepan, heat vegetable oil and cook meatballs until browned, stirring often. Spoon off all but 1 tablespoon drippings. Add carrots, celery and green pepper strips and cook for 5 minutes. Add beef broth, zesty tomato soup and water. Heat to boiling, add pasta and cook on low for 10 minutes or until pasta is cooked.

CHICKEN A LA ITALIANO

by CAROL LUMSDEN

2cups Progresso Italian bread crumbs

1cup grated Parmesan cheese

1beaten egg

4doubled, boneless, skinless chicken breasts, split

1can College Inn chicken broth

Cut each breast in two. Mix bread crumbs and cheese. Dip chicken pieces in beaten egg; then into crumb mixture. Fry in oil until brown. Drain on paper towels. Put in 9- by 13-inch dish and pour chicken broth over. Cover with foil and bake 1 hour at 350 degrees. Serves 8.

ABOUT THE BOOK

The cookbook is a commemorative collection of party recipes by the Angels of Easter Seals and the Easter Seals staff and board members.
